{Mini Digger vs. Tractor for Land Clearing

When tackling a land clearing project , choosing the right equipment is vital. Both a compact excavator and a articulated loader are popular options , but they operate differently. A small digger generally delivers superior trenching power and control for uprooting trees and handling bulky debris. Conversely, a skid-steer loader is often considerably flexible and easier to maneuver , especially in limited spaces , and its scoop can be readily swapped with multiple implements for tasks like smoothing and material handling .

How Much Does Land Clearing Really Cost?

Determining a figure for land removal can be quite complex. Several factors affect the overall price. Generally, you can expect to pay anywhere from $1 to $5 per square foot, but this is merely an estimate. The area of the property is a significant driver – bigger parcels typically involve higher costs. Furthermore, the ground's slope, the presence of timber's density, vegetation, stones, and any necessary authorization costs all play a role. Finally, the type of clearing required – whether it's full vegetation removal or just partial clearing – will substantially affect the ultimate bill.

Property Clearing Costs Breakdown: Elements Influencing Your Estimate

The overall expense of land clearing can differ significantly, and understanding the elements driving those charges is essential for realistic budgeting. Labor represents a major portion, impacted by landscape ; steep ground requires more work. Vegetation density also plays a critical role – clearing a densely wooded area is considerably more costly than removing sparse growth . Equipment rental costs – including bulldozers, excavators, and mulchers – add to the overall statement. Finally, licenses and hauling of debris can be additional expenses .
